Job Description
Dis-Chem Pharmacies has an opportunity available for a their New Store in Pinelands. The purpose of the role is to manage the health division within the store, this entails stock control, working towards achieving sales targets, managing in-store promotions, implementing head office initiatives.
Minimum Requirements:
Essential:
Grade 12 / Matric
Minimum of 3 years’ retail and sales experience
Minimum of 1-year experience in supervision/management of a staff complement of between 3 and 8 people
Computer literate – MS Office
Advantageous:
Qualification within the health focus category
Relevant experience in the vitamins, supplements and health food industry
SAP experience
Qlikview experience
Job Specification:
Direct and support sales staff under the guidance of the Store Manager and in accordance with the Dis-Chem policies, procedures and retail working practices.
Ensure implementation of Head office, Regional Manager and Regional Health Manager Strategy and initiatives.
Manage staff member performance through the performance management system.
Ensure the Health Division is adequately staffed at all times, and establish an appropriate work roster.
Manage all in-store promoters for the department.
Manage and address customer compliments and complaints.
Serve customers and implement a high standard of customer care and service.
Maintain merchandising and displays, to ensure a high standard of cleanliness.
Ensure all goods are correctly priced and labelled.
Working towards achieving department, vendor, brand, products and sales objectives.
Ensure monthly promotions are implemented effectively to maximise its objectives.
Maintain optimal stock levels through effective planning, monitoring and ordering of stock.
Manage sales representatives and direct supplier orders.
Ensure proper stock rotation to prevent the stock from expiring.
Manage back shopping in the designated areas.
Be accountable and manage stock control through effective planning and ordering of stock in collaboration with Dis-Chem’s warehouse and suppliers.
